New Jersey mob boss Tony Soprano deals with personal and professional issues in his home and business life that affect his mental state, leading him to seek professional psychiatric counseling.
In 2013, the Writers Guild of America named The Sopranos the best-written TV series of all time, while TV Guide ranked it the best television series of all time. In 2016 and 2022, the series came in first place on the Rolling Stone list of the 100 greatest TV shows of all time.
The Sopranos is an American crime drama television series created by David Chase. The series follows Tony Soprano ( James Gandolfini ), an Italian-American mobster, as he struggles with various personal and professional obstacles.
